> >What is the relation between frames and lines? The lines here means the 
> >ones used in nsBlockFrame.
> 
> If I'm understanding this correctly..
> 
> Frames are the actual layout objects (boxes, in CSS terms).
> Lines represent line boxes: they organize the layout of
> inline frames within a line.

Right, but we also have an nsLineBox for blocks that are children of
blocks.  (One nsLineBox per child block.)
